Not correct. Here is how the BLEND is different from the WIDE:
1)Different core wood. The Blend's is lighter (Poplar in stead of Maple)
2)Different carbon pattern. The Wide had 5 thin stripes down the center, the Blend has a big fat sheet the same shape as the metal matrix in the Prophet.
3)Mount point (and thus the center of the sidecut) is further back on the Blend.
4)The Wide came in longer lenghs (above 180)
5) The ration of tip to tail widths is different on the Blend, it has a bigger tip relative to tail than the Wide did.
So, to field your original question about stiffness, I'd say the Blends are a little softer than the Wides were.
